Regular Roof Inspections Are Essential
One of the best ways to extend your roof’s life is to have it inspected regularly. A roof inspection is like a health check for your home’s top layer. It helps find small problems before they turn into big ones. Hamilton County, NY roofing company professionals suggest having a roof inspection at least twice a year — once in the spring and once in the fall. Inspections are especially important after strong storms or heavy snow.
During an inspection, a roofing expert will look for signs of damage such as broken shingles, leaks, cracked flashing, or clogged gutters. They will also check if there are any areas where water or ice can collect and cause problems. Finding these issues early means they can be fixed quickly, preventing more serious damage.
Even if you don’t notice any visible damage, regular inspections can help spot hidden problems. This saves you money and stress in the long run because small repairs are much cheaper than replacing an entire roof.
Keep Your Gutters Clean and Clear
Gutters play a very important role in protecting your roof. They catch rainwater and direct it away from your home’s foundation. If gutters get clogged with leaves, dirt, or debris, water can back up and cause damage to your roof edges and walls.
A trusted Hamilton County, NY roofing company will tell you that cleaning your gutters at least twice a year is key to extending your roof’s life. During the fall, gutters fill quickly with falling leaves, and in spring, they might collect twigs and dirt left over from winter storms. If water stays on your roof too long, it can seep under shingles and cause leaks.
When gutters are clean and free of blockages, water flows smoothly off your roof and away from your home. This prevents ice dams in the winter, which can tear shingles and create water damage inside your house. So make sure to check and clean your gutters regularly or hire a professional to do it safely.
Trim Nearby Trees and Branches
Trees give shade and beauty to your property, but they can also be a risk to your roof if not managed well. Branches that hang over your roof can scrape shingles during windy days. They can also drop leaves and twigs that clog gutters or collect on your roof surface.
Hamilton County, NY roofing company experts recommend trimming any tree branches that are too close to your roof. This helps prevent physical damage and keeps your roof cleaner. It also reduces the chance of animals, like squirrels or birds, making nests in your gutters or attic.
If branches fall during storms, they can crack or puncture your roof, causing leaks that damage the inside of your home. Regular tree trimming is a simple step to protect your roof and keep it in good condition.

Choose Quality Roofing Materials
The materials used on your roof play a big role in how long it lasts. When it’s time to replace or repair your roof, choosing high-quality materials is an investment that pays off. Stronger materials resist wind, rain, and temperature changes better than cheaper alternatives.
Hamilton County, NY roofing company professionals work with many types of roofing materials such as asphalt shingles, metal, slate, or wood shakes. Each material has its own advantages depending on your home’s style and the local weather.
For example, metal roofs are known for their long life and durability in snowy regions. Asphalt shingles are popular because they are affordable and easy to install. Your roofing professional can help you pick the best material that fits your budget and offers good protection.
Using quality materials combined with expert installation ensures your roof will last for many years and save you money on repairs down the road.
Proper Attic Ventilation Protects Your Roof
Many people don’t realize how important attic ventilation is for roof health. Proper airflow in your attic helps control temperature and moisture levels. Without good ventilation, heat and moisture build up under your roof, which can cause shingles to warp or decay faster.
Hamilton County, NY roofing company experts always check attic ventilation during inspections. They make sure your home has enough vents to let hot air escape in summer and moisture to leave in winter. This reduces the chance of ice dams forming and protects your roof structure from damage.
If your attic doesn’t have proper ventilation, your roofing professional can add ridge vents, soffit vents, or other systems to improve airflow. This simple fix can add years to your roof’s life by preventing many common roofing problems.
